Job Overview:
We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Collection Representative to join our team. As a Collection Representative, you will be responsible for contacting individuals and insurance companies to collect outstanding debts. The ideal candidate will have strong communication skills, excellent problem-solving abilities, and a customer service-oriented mindset.
Responsibilities:
- Contact individuals and insurance companies to collect outstanding debts
- Negotiate payment arrangements and settlements
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of all collection activities
- Follow company policies and procedures for debt collection
- Handle inbound and outbound calls in a professional and courteous manner
- Provide exceptional customer service while maintaining successful payment collection
- Utilize medical terminology and account coding knowledge to effectively communicate with healthcare providers and insurance companies
- Perform account reconciliation to ensure accuracy of debt records
- Conduct account analysis to identify delinquent accounts and develop strategies for collection
Experience:
- Previous experience in collections preferred
- Familiarity with medical terminology, account coding, and insurance processes is a plus
- Proficiency in using electronic medical records for data entry and record keeping
- Excellent customer service skills with the ability to handle difficult conversations professionally
- Strong problem-solving abilities and attention to detail
